What Is Material Burden. Burden rate is the rate at which indirect costs are allocated to direct costs to give a truer picture of the cost to produce or deliver something. Burden is a practical and meaningful method of allocating your indirect costs to specific jobs. Budgeting for direct costs is generally easy. A burden cost refers to the hidden labor and inventory charges companies pay in their manufacturing processes. Contractors allocate a cost pool by applying a burden rate or rates. The burden rate is the allocation rate at which indirect costs are applied to the direct costs of either labor or inventory. Your burden rate (s) provide a truer picture of total costs than direct costs alone. It is helpful for small businesses to calculate these numbers as burden costs can affect a company’s profitability.
